在JSON中,符号“@”通常用来表示特殊的含义或者功能。它可以被用来标识JSON对象中的某些属性或者键,并与相应的值进行关联。
JSON中的“@”的含义和用法在JSON中,使用“@”符号可以表示以下几种含义和用法:1. 关键字:在一些特定的上下文中,“@”符号被用作关键字,表示某种特殊的含义或功能。例如,在JSON Schema中,“@”符号被用作关键字前缀,用于表示一些特定的约束或规则。2. 元数据:在某些JSON数据结构中,“@”符号被用来表示元数据,即对数据本身的描述或注释。例如,在GeoJSON中,“@”符号可以用来表示地理数据的一些元数据信息,如坐标参考系统或坐标精度等。3. 特殊属性:有时候,“@”符号在JSON对象的属性或键中使用,表示该属性或键具有特殊的含义或功能。例如,在JavaScript Object Notation for Linking Data(JSON-LD)中,属性“@context”用来指定JSON-LD文档中的上下文信息,从而定义了文档中使用的术语和语义。案例代码下面是一个使用JSON中的“@”符号的案例代码,展示了如何使用“@”符号表示特殊属性和元数据:json{ "@context": { "@vocab": "http://example.com/vocab#", "name": "http://xmlns.com/foaf/0.1/name" }, "@type": "Person", "name": "John Doe", "age": 30}在上述代码中,使用了“@context”属性来定义了文档中使用的术语和语义。同时,“@type”属性用来指定该JSON对象的类型为“Person”。而“name”属性则表示该人物的姓名。通过使用“@”符号,可以明确表示这些属性具有特殊的含义或功能。在JSON中,“@”符号常常用来表示特殊的含义或功能,例如关键字、元数据或特殊属性。通过使用“@”符号,可以使JSON数据更加丰富和具有更多的表达能力。了解和正确使用“@”符号的含义和用法,有助于更好地理解和处理JSON数据。参考代码来源:https://json-ld.org/